The biography delves into the life of Leslie Halliwell, a pivotal figure in film history known for creating "The Filmgoer's Companion" in 1965, the first comprehensive one-volume reference on cinema. It explores his contributions as a film encyclopaedist and television impresario, highlighting his influence on film appreciation and scholarship. Through detailed research, the book reveals Halliwell's dedication to the art of film and his lasting legacy in the world of cinema.
